stuffed acorn squash
Two of these make a hearty meal.
prep time
10 Min
cook time
1 Hr 20 Min
method
Bake
yield
2 serving(s)
Ingredients
- 2 acorn squash, halved and seeded
- 1 cup water
- 1/2 pound ground beef
- 1 medium onion, chopped
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- - salt and pepper, to taste
- 1 cup cooked rice
- 1 granny smith apple, peeled, cored, and diced
- 1/4 cup pepitas
- 1 teaspoon curry powder
- 4 tablespoons brown sugar
- 4 tablespoons butter
How To Make stuffed acorn squash
-
Step 1Preheat oven 350 degrees F. Place the squash cut side down in a baking dish. Pour the water around the squash. Place foil over top the dish and bake for 60 minutes.
-
Step 2Meanwhile, cook the beef, onion, and garlic until the meat is done. Season with salt and pepper. Drain. Add the rice, apple, pepitas, and curry powder. Cook until the apple is softened.
-
Step 3Remove the squash from the oven. Pour out the water, turn the squash over, and season with salt. Place a Tbsp of brown sugar and a Tbsp of butter in each half of squash. Fill each half with the meat mixture and add back to oven for 20 more minutes. Serve.
